Skyline Ventures India Ltd held an Extra Ordinary General Meeting on December 31, 2025, which was requisitioned by shareholders under Section 100 of the Companies Act, 2013, rather than being called by the Board. The meeting was chaired by a requisitionist-member, Mr. Madhu Mohan Avalur, instead of the regular Chairman. Shareholders passed 8 special resolutions covering the appointment of three new directors (Kantheti Phanindra Varma, Madhu Mohan Avalur, and Venkata Satya Subrahmanyam Mukkavalli) and the removal of three existing directors (Asha Mitta, Anil, and Hannah Priyadarshini). Additional resolutions approved the appointment of a forensic auditor to review past Board transactions, barred the Board from entering agreements without shareholder approval, and suspended an existing agreement with Verrkotech Solutions Private Limited. All resolutions were passed with the requisite majority through e-voting.
